The NeverMind of Brian Hildebrand by Martin Myers
My rating: 5 of 5 stars

Witty, smart, funny and entertaining.
Love the writing style of this author.
The ramblings of a comatose patient that is aware of his surroundings, and as he puts it: locked-in.
The narrative is engaging and filled with humor.
What makes this story great, is the attempts to "un-lock" Brian. Unconventional, weird and imaginative methods are used to bring him back, but the most important is the willingness and support of the staff and family.
